Test Proctoring

Research staff at both locations proctor written, e-mailed, or online exams. Online Exams can be completed using library computers, but the computer setting will not be modified to accommodate an online test.

A minimum of one-week notice is required before any test will be proctored. It is the responsibility of the student to schedule an appointment and make all arrangements.  

Students needing a test proctored should contact the Research staff in person, by phone at (618) 452-6238, or by email  at [email protected]. Exams will be administered based on student availability and the availability of the proctor.    

The testing institution usually follows up by contacting the Research staff person who will serve as the proctor.The student should call again or email prior to the testing appointment to ensure the test or login information has arrived. (The proctor will not contact the student when the exam arrives.)  The student will be required to present a valid picture I.D. at the time of the exam and will be responsible for any associated fees, including postage, copy, or fax fees.

The proctor will enforce any time limits that are placed on the exam, as well as other rules set forth in the examination materials.  They will not sign a proctoring verification that attests to more than they have been able to do. The exam must be completed, copies made as appropriate, and documents signed at least 15 minutes before Library closing.  Exams received by SMRLD, but not completed by the student, will be discarded after 30 days.  SMRLD reserves the right to deny proctoring service.
